As a Senior Clinical Trial Manager at ICON, you will manage clinical trial operations activities, supporting your team and stakeholders to deliver high-quality outcomes across our clinical programs
What You Will Do:
Your focus will be on coordinating clinical trial management delivery, resolving issues, and developing team capability.
Key responsibilities include:
* Budget Oversight the clinical portion of the budget to ensure efficient resource allocation.
* Ensuring Effective Study Oversight: Develop monitoring plans and tools, ensuring effective study oversight.
* Optimizing Performance: Train and mentor Clinical Research Associates (CRAs) to optimize their performance.
* Timely Study Start-Up & Enrollment: Drive enrollment and lead study start-up activities, adhering to timelines.
* Improving Study Integrity Review trip reports and implement corrective and preventative action plans when necessary.
* Building Productive Relationships: Foster productive relationships with Sponsor, vendors, and cross-functional teams.
Your Profile:
You will have solid clinical trial management experience, with the ability to manage competing priorities and develop your team.
Required qualifications and experience:
* Strong experience in a Senior CRA or CTM position at a CRO or Pharmaceutical Organization.
* Bachelor's degree in health, life sciences, or other relevant fields of study.
* Preferred: 2+ years of monitoring experience.
* Ability to manage multiple vendors and stakeholders
* Contribution to the implementation and optimization of hubs
* Risk management
* Data-driven decision making (DDM)
* Ability to manage a high workload with multiple priorities
* Use of digital tools (eConsent) and AI implementation
* Strong Communication and Site Engagement Skills
